Newer fire-resistant glass is not reinforced by cable but is just as solid. The cord in wired glass quits glass from ruining in heats. As a result of thisit is utilized in fire windows and doors near emergency exit. Solar control glass has a special finishing developed to block excessive warmth from the sun from travelling through the glass.

Proivacy glass, additionally called obscured glass, enables light in yet misshapes the sight with the glass. This glass has a rigid laminate layer heat-sealed in between two layers of glass, among which gives significantly enhanced strength and "tear" resistance. Double-glazed units, typically referred to as i nsulated glass, is in fact a collection (or "system") of two or 3 sheets of glass inside a door or home window framework. Occasionally you will discover sliding home windows with the alternative to move either panel. Double-hung windows have 2 sections, upper and lower, called "sashes" in which the glass is fitted. On double-hung home windows, both sashes can be moved so you can choose to open up either the top of the window or the bottom. Depending upon the style, the sashes can either slide backwards and forwards or tilt open.
